Under Secretary Mancuso Visits China

On December 10-11, Under Secretary Mancuso visited Beijing as part of Secretary Gutierrez’s delegation to the U.S. - China Joint Commission on Commerce and Trade (JCCT). On the occasion of the JCCT, Under Secretary Mancuso and MOFCOM Vice Minister Wei Jiangguo signed “Guidelines for U.S.-China High Technology and Strategic Trade Development”, which outline the importance of working cooperatively to achieve the mutual benefits of promoting U.S. high technology exports to China.

In addition to meeting with his counterparts at MOFCOM and other Chinese government ministries, Under Secretary Mancuso participated in the U.S.-China Innovation Conference, met with the American Chamber of Commerce in China, and conducted private sector outreach in Beijing and Shanghai.

On December 13, Under Secretary Mancuso traveled to Shanghai to meet with senior U.S. industry executives and visited the Shanghai Aircraft Manufacturing Factory.
